Description: The United States Coast Guard (USCG) intends to solicit and negotiate a sole source contract with Flight Safety International for initial, recurrent and advanced training services for pilots, mechanics, and crew operating or maintaining Gulfstream GVIII-G700 aircraft.
Authority: This action is being conducted under the authority of 10 U.S.C. 3204(a)(1), as implemented by RFO Subpart 6.103-1 (Only One Responsible Source and No Other Supplies or Services Will Satisfy Agency Requirements).
Justification: The USCG recently acquired two Gulfstream GVIII-G700 aircraft to recapitalize and expand the USCG fleet. Gulfstream GVIII-G700 aircraft training for pilots, technicians, and cabin attendants requires model specific Level D simulators and FAA approved training curricula. The Government has determined that Flight Safety International is the only source capable of providing this specialized training.
Disclaimer: This announcement constitutes the only notice of this intent. A formal solicitation will not be issued. However, all responsible sources may submit a capability statement demonstrating their ability to meet the USCG's requirements. Any capability statements received will be considered for the purpose of determining to cancel action and conduct a competitive procurement.
NAICS Code and Size Standard: The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code for this acquisition is 611512 (Professional Organizations), with a small business size standard of $34 million.
Response Instructions: Interested parties may submit capability statements electronically to jessica.a.griffin@uscg.mil no later than June 8, 2026 11:59PM. Capability statements should clearly and concisely demonstrate the offeror's technical qualifications, experience, and ability to provide GVIII-G700 aircraft training for pilots, technicians, and cabin attendants utilizing model specific Level D simulators and FAA approved training curricula.
